Abstract

Traveling salesman problem (TSP), a typical NP-hard problem, is one of the hot researching topics in the combined optimization area. It has already attracted many researchers from all areas. CTSP, a promotion of TSP deformation, is more complex than TSP, and has a wide range of applications. Genetic algorithm (GA) has the ability of conducting a stochastic global searching. However, using ability of feedback information is poor,convergence is slow, and its solving efficiency is low. Ant colony system (ACS) algorithm not only has the ability of parallel global searching, but also can avoid converging to a local minimal solution to possibility of stopping evolution. It lacks initial information and slow convergence. GA and ACS can be combined into CIA,which can be used to solve CTSP, having good properties of fully using information and fast convergence.
